Yarra City Council’s Collection was founded in 1994, based on the range of artworks and cultural artefacts that the City of Yarra inherited when the municipalities of Collingwood, Richmond and Fitzroy amalgamated.

The Collection comprises over 1,030 items and aims to reflect the artistic, cultural, social, environmental, and historical context of the City of Yarra. It includes civic, art and public art items that reflect Yarra's local cultural heritage and the city’s unique history and people.

Our Collection Policy

Yarra City Council’s Collection Policy sets out the principles and practices that guide decision-making about Council’s art and heritage collection. This includes how the collection is developed, documented, conserved, interpreted and made accessible to the community. Our current Collection Policy was developed in 2020, now it’s time for a refresh.
